Cornelus' birth was registered as illigitemate under the name of his mother. His uncle Gerrit was a witness on his birth certificate. He was legitamized at the wedding of his parents.
He lived in haarlem, but moved to the province of Drente. At the time of his own wedding (1856) he was living in Assen, while his parents lived in Haarlem. His parents did not attend the wedding and instead sent a notarized consent form.
He worked at the tree nursery in Smilde called "De Eikenterpen", which was sold in 1868. During the sale Cornelis handled the auction of the wood. Source Newspaper: Algemeen Handelsblad January 25 1868, pg. 4. and Algemeen Handelsblad January 28 1868, pg. 4.
On 30 October 1877 the family left Smilde to move to Berkel en Rodenrijs (Source Population Registry Smilde), but there is no evidence that they ever arrived there.
Lived in Amsterdam (Quellijnstraat 130 and Fokke Simonszstraat 54 and Jan van der Heijdenstraat 216) at some point between 1874 and 1893 with daughter Franciska.
The youngest child, Johannus, was born in Maarsseveen in 1880. Daughter Catharina married in Maarsseveen in 1882, but the family was living in Niewer-Amstel at the time. 2 Children were married in Niewer-Amstel (in 1885 and 1886) and 2 children in Bussum (1892 and 1903).
His profession was listed as stoker (adding coal to fire of steam train engines) at the wedding of his daughter Catharina in 1882. The family was living in Niewer-Amstel at that time.
